Yeah, it's something of a rarity to have a client/architect that doesn't mind me not filling the scene with "life" as they so often call it. I know a lot of people feel quite strongly about showing buildings with people in, because that's why they are designed in the first place; but I think a building should be able to stand alone and look great. Yeah, those fireflies were really annoying which I shall explain in a second... @unknownuser said: I like 'em.  However, they're a tad too noisy, and your AA isn't great. However, they're a tad too noisy, and your AA isn't great.I know, and this is the same reason the fireflies are in the dusk image; time. I had to reduce the render settings due to the fact the images weren't rendering fast enough - they were needed for the next day so I simply couldn't take any chances. In hindsight I've learnt so much since I did this project that I'd love to be able to go back and apply to it, but I just don't have the time.
